What You’ll Do
Position Summary
The Registered Dietitian (RD) will work with a multidisciplinary team atSuvidaHealthcare to assess the nutritional needs of our patients and improve nutrition equity in our neighborhoods. This role is integrated into the care model ofSuvidaand requiresexpertisein working with patients with multiple chronic conditions. This clinician will work across the care spectrum from prevention to treatmentutilizingthe best technology and tools to provide high-quality andequitablenutrition care for our patients.
The RD willparticipateinSuvida’slifestyle medicine program which includes manyfoodas medicineinterventions like culinary medicine and food prescriptions. You will work withSuvida’sleadership and care team to develop and implement culturally relevant care programs that address social determinants of health, improve patient outcomes, and increase patient satisfaction.
Responsibilities
- Provide nutrition counseling rooted in deep cultural humility and inclusivity to support the individualized nutritional care plans forSuvidapatients.
- Work collaboratively with multidisciplinary team and community-based organizations to address nutrition insecurity and other related social and structural determinates of health.
- Provide inclinic, virtual and home-basedindividualand group nutrition care forSuvidapatients.
- Lead culinary medicine classes and collaborate with otherSuvidaexperts to develop and deliver lifestyle medicine programming that promotesoptimalnutrition andhealth
- Assistwith the development ofSuvida’slifestyle medicine programming (culinary medicine, food RX, etc.).
- Provide interdisciplinary education and training to integrate and communicate nutrition principles that enhance patient outcomes.
- Collaborate as an integral member of the multidisciplinary health care team to implement nutrition care plans,establishand maintain policies, standards, and programs foroptimal, cost-effective nutrition care forSuvida’spatients.

What You’ll Bring
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ities
- 3+ years of experience as a Registered Dietitian (adult geriatrics preferred)
- Bilingual (English and Spanish)required
- Experience teaching culinary medicineclasses
- Experience working in lifestyle medicine related initiatives (culinary medicine, food RX, gardening, medically tailored meals)preferred
- Fitness and movement experiencepreferred
- Social media experiencepreferred
Education, Experience, Licensure, or Certification Requirements
- Bachelor’s or advanced degree in Dietetics, Food and Nutrition or related field (Master’sdegree preferred)
- Registered Dietitian Nutritionist (RDN) or Registered Dietitian (RD)
- Licensed Dietitian (LD) State of Texas or eligible within60 daysof hire
